ERLANGER, KY (FOX19)- Police are investigating what they are now calling a homicide in Erlanger.
Officials were called to a home in the 3100 block of Hulbert Avenue near Division Street around 5 p.m. Monday night for a wellness check by a third party. Upon arrival, they found the back door open and a deceased female inside the residence.
The victim has been identified as Tasha Nichole Campbell, 26, of Cleves.
Police have named Timothy Grissett, 50, as a suspect in Campbell's murder. He is a white male, 5'8" and 165 pounds with blue eyes and brown hair. He has a tattoo on his left hand and left arm and is missing his right leg. He is possibly driving a 2004 blue Honda Accord with Ohio temporary tag #V857632 that has been listed as stolen. He is considered dangerous.
Anyone with information on Grissett's whereabouts should call Erlanger Police at 859-727-2424.
Grissett has a criminal past that includes serving 15 years in prison for aggravated burglary several years ago.
Police have not released any connection between Grissett and Campbell. Investigators say Grissett lived in the home where Campbell was found, but it's unclear why she was there.
The Kenton County Coroner's Office will determine Campbell's cause of death. Friends of Campbell say she had a young son and she had been doing some modeling.
